阴阳师脚本多开模拟器问题全解析:从故障排查到稳定运行
【免费下载链接】OnmyojiAutoScriptOnmyoji Auto Script | 阴阳师脚本项目地址: https://gitcode.com/gh_mirrors/on/OnmyojiAutoScript
如何识别多开模拟器的典型故障现象?
当使用OnmyojiAutoScript进行多开操作时,模拟器群可能出现各种异常表现。最常见的三种故障模式包括:
应用识别混乱:脚本启动后提示"检测到多个游戏版本",如MuMu模拟器中同时存在"阴阳师正式服"和"体验服"两个包体,导致自动化流程卡在选择界面。
设备连接失败:脚本日志反复出现"无法连接127.0.0.1:21503"等类似提示,就像拨打占线的电话,始终无法建立有效通信。
窗口控制失灵:模拟器能启动但脚本无法执行点击操作,日志显示"找不到有效窗口句柄",如同对着空气操作鼠标。
这些问题通常不会孤立出现,多开环境中往往混合多种故障类型,需要系统排查。
如何定位多开模拟器失败的根源?
设备识别链检查
模拟器与脚本的通信就像快递配送系统,需要完整的"地址-门牌号-收件人"信息链:
模拟器命名规范检查
打开任务管理器查看窗口标题,确保没有"模拟器-1"、"新模拟器"这类默认名称。纯数字命名(如"666")或包含特殊符号(如"阴阳师_副本&")的名称会导致脚本识别混乱。ADB端口映射验证
步骤1:打开模拟器设置→开发者选项→ADB端口配置
步骤2:记录每个模拟器的端口号(如MuMu默认7555,多开时应依次递增为7556、7557)
步骤3:在命令提示符输入adb devices,确认所有端口均显示为"device"状态应用唯一性确认
在模拟器设置→应用管理中检查,确保每个实例只保留一个阴阳师包体(通常为com.netease.onmyoji),卸载测试服、渠道服等多余版本。
环境干扰因素排查
🔍系统显示设置检查:右键桌面→显示设置,确保缩放比例为100%。高DPI缩放会导致脚本截图坐标计算偏差,就像用放大镜看地图却按实际尺寸走路。
⚠️后台进程冲突:打开任务管理器结束多余的adb.exe进程,这些残留进程会占用端口资源,造成新模拟器无法连接。
如何解决多开模拟器的连接与识别问题?
规范模拟器配置方案
✅标准化命名体系
为每个模拟器创建唯一且有意义的名称,推荐格式:用途_序号_特征,例如:
- "突破_01_正式服"
- "副本_02_体验服"
- "活动_03_B服"
✅端口映射配置
以MuMu模拟器为例:
- 点击多开器→配置→高级设置
- 设置起始端口为21503,勾选"端口自动递增"
- 确认"开启ADB调试"已勾选
- 重启所有模拟器使设置生效
✅应用环境清理
步骤1:在模拟器内长按阴阳师图标→卸载
步骤2:通过官方渠道重新安装单一版本
步骤3:启动游戏完成初始化后再关闭,确保生成正确的应用数据
脚本配置精确化
在OnmyojiAutoScript的配置文件中(通常位于config目录下),为每个模拟器实例添加明确配置:
# 示例配置:为三个模拟器实例分别设置 emulators: - name: "突破_01_正式服" serial: "127.0.0.1:21503" package_name: "com.netease.onmyoji" - name: "副本_02_体验服" serial: "127.0.0.1:21504" package_name: "com.netease.onmyoji" - name: "活动_03_B服" serial: "127.0.0.1:21505" package_name: "com.netease.onmyoji.bilibili"如何预防多开模拟器故障的再次发生?
建立多开环境维护清单
| 检查项目 | 检查周期 | 标准状态 | 维护操作 |
|---|---|---|---|
| 模拟器名称规范 | 每次新增实例 | 包含用途、序号、渠道信息 | 使用标准化命名格式 |
| ADB端口占用 | 每周一次 | 连续递增且无冲突 | 使用netstat -ano检查端口占用 |
| 应用版本一致性 | 每次游戏更新后 | 所有实例版本统一 | 通过模拟器批量更新功能同步版本 |
| 系统缩放设置 | 每月检查 | 保持100%缩放 | 在显示设置中锁定缩放比例 |
| 脚本配置备份 | 每次修改后 | 保留历史版本 | 使用Git或手动备份config目录 |
多开操作最佳实践
分批启动策略
不要同时启动所有模拟器,建议每30秒启动一个实例,给系统足够的资源分配时间。就像交通高峰期分流通行,避免系统"堵车"。资源分配优化
根据电脑配置合理分配资源:- 4核8G内存电脑建议最多开3个模拟器
- 8核16G内存可支持5-6个实例
- 每个模拟器分配2G内存和2核CPU即可满足需求
定期环境重置
每月对模拟器进行一次"三清"操作:- 清除应用缓存
- 重启ADB服务
- 重建脚本配置文件
图:OnmyojiAutoScript的主界面图标,通过清晰的配置面板可管理多开模拟器参数
通过以上系统化的排查流程和规范化的配置方案,多数多开模拟器问题都能得到有效解决。记住,稳定的多开环境建立在清晰的命名规则、正确的端口配置和干净的应用环境之上。当遇到新问题时,优先检查ADB连接状态和窗口识别情况,这两个环节往往是故障的主要来源。
【免费下载链接】OnmyojiAutoScriptOnmyoji Auto Script | 阴阳师脚本项目地址: https://gitcode.com/gh_mirrors/on/OnmyojiAutoScript
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考